  5. Hi Nico, I still believe that the new direction to handling airport files is not ideal. Currently, you need to log into the simulator to have the file for the loaded airport appear in the PSXT/Airports folder. The current system is not suitable for the following: I cannot modify airport files without launching the simulator, even on another computer. (Until now, I used to copy the files I wanted to modify onto a USB drive, make the changes on my work computer, then test the results on my home computer. If necessary, I would correct the mistakes. I would then send the tested files to you.) It is not suitable for testing the modified parameters myself, since the park_airport file is downloaded online, and I cannot overwrite it. If I purchased the airport from the marketplace, the stock file is automatically loaded. This used to be fixable by simply overwriting the stock files in the stock folder with the modified third-party files. I suggest that the airport files database continues to be downloaded to the computer, remains accessible, and can be freely edited and tested at home. This would also solve the marketplace problem. Other: I see that the radius values have changed in many files, even though I fixed them. This can also cause errors in parking.

  9. Hi Nico! I will write down the history for all to see: >why is it that after "x" hours PSXT starts filling the parking spaces again with static planes? Where did you read that? Each 20 minutes PSXT updates the static parked aircraft situation, according to the data in the airport file. If you do not want these updates you must check the ILO button >If I press the Flush button, only the live planes remain, but the moving ones are duplicated, and a frozen plane remains in their place. If you press the Flush button, all static parked aircraft will be removed. Nothing happens to the live aircraft. And it does not duplicate moving aircraft during a flush. You may sometimes see double aircraft ("ghosts"), but that is because of problems in RT traffic data. Normally one of them will be removed after a minute or so. I've been testing PSXT for many hours now, and I wrote based on that. 1. The ILO button is always checked for me, yet after a while (not 20 minutes, but a few hours) it regenerates the static planes. 2. Pressing the Flush button, based on the test, does indeed duplicate the currently moving aircraft. One copy remains frozen in its last position, the other copy continues according to the RT data.
